Paris: From Piaf to Pop

Christine Bovill travels into the 60s and the Americanisation of French music: le yé-yé. A time of great cultural change in France, would the high art of chanson survive...? This sell-out show at the 2022 Edinburgh Fringe, offers a sensuous and delicious celebration of the Golden Age of French song and how it evolved during the Swinging Sixties. Singing in both French and English, Bovill honours many stars including Edith Piaf, Jacques Brel, Serge Gainsbourg and Francoise Hardy.
